/**
* paj@gaiterjones.com
* MEMCACHE wrapper class - for all round cache fun.
*
* version 2016 for MYSQLi
*
*
* @category PAJ
* @package
* @license http://www.gnu.org/licenses/ GNU General Public License
*
NOTE class is using PHP memcache, not memcached.
installation on ubuntu:
apt-get install memcached
apt-get install php5-memcache
Flush cache from command line:
(sleep 2; echo flush_all; sleep 2; echo quit; ) | telnet 127.0.0.1 11212
Manually flush cache
telnet localhost 11211
flush_all
quit
CacheDump - use ?dumpcache&filtercache=keytofilter
*
*/

// stores data in the cache with versioned namespace
//
public function cacheSetWithNameSpace($_key,$_data,$_cacheNameSpace='global',$_ttl=false)
{
$this->set('namespace',$_cacheNameSpace);
$this->loadVersion();
// get cache version to use in key, incrementing cache version invalidates key
$_version=$this->get('namespacekeyversion');
// build memcache key
$_key=$_key.'-'.$_cacheNameSpace.'-v'. $_version.'-'. $this->get('appcachekey');
$this->set('namespacecachekey',$_key);
// add rows to cache
$this->cacheSet($_key, $_data, $_ttl);
}
// retrieves data from the cache with versioned namespace
//
public function cacheGetWithNameSpace($_key,$_cacheNameSpace='global')
{
$this->set('namespace',$_cacheNameSpace);
$this->loadVersion();
// get cache version to use in key, incrementing cache version invalidates key
$_version=$this->get('namespacekeyversion');
// build memcache key
$_key=$_key.'-'.$_cacheNameSpace.'-v'. $_version.'-'. $this->get('appcachekey');
$this->set('namespacecachekey',$_key);
// get data from cache
return $this->cacheGet($_key);
}
// Cached SQL query function. Returns either cached query or DB query as array
//
//
private function cacheQuery($_query)
{
$_cacheNameSpace = $this->get('namespace');
// get cache version to use in key, incrementing cache version invalidates key
$_version=$this->get('namespacekeyversion');
// build memcache key
$_key=$_cacheNameSpace.'-v'. $_version.'-'. $this->get('appcachekey'). '-'. md5($_query);
$this->set('namespacecachekey',$_key);
// attempt to get query results from cache
$_cachedRows=$this->cacheGet($_key);
if (!$_cachedRows) // no data in cache, retrieve from database
{
mysqli_select_db($this->con,$this->get('dbname'));
$_result=mysqli_query($this->con,$_query); // perfrom query
if (!$_result) throw new \Exception(get_class($this). " query failed: " . mysqli_error($this->con));
$_allRows = array();
// dump rows into array
while ($_rows = mysqli_fetch_array($_result,MYSQLI_ASSOC)) {
$_allRows[] = $_rows;
}
// add rows to cache
$this->cacheSet($_key, serialize($_allRows));
$this->set('datacached',false);
return $_allRows;
}
// return cached data
$this->set('datacached',true);
return unserialize($_cachedRows);
}
// increments key version variable
// held in memcache to invalidate
// stale records
public function incVersion($_cacheNameSpace='global') {
$this->set('namespace',$_cacheNameSpace); // set namespace
$this->increment($_cacheNameSpace); // increment version key
}
